How they compare

Türkiye currently reports 169,681 t against 18,866 t in Syrian Arab Republic, a difference of 150,815 t.

That makes Türkiye's figure about 9.0 times Syrian Arab Republic's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Türkiye ahead.

Syrian Arab Republic ranks 14th and Türkiye ranks 11th of 22 countries.

Türkiye has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Syrian Arab Republic Türkiye Difference Ahead
1990s 19,664 t 272,155 t 252,492 t Türkiye
2000s 5,337 t 142,949 t 137,612 t Türkiye
2010s 69,012 t 180,215 t 111,203 t Türkiye
2020s 40,474 t 157,583 t 117,109 t Türkiye

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
